Chad: France and Qatar negotiate in secret over Idriss Deby's future

The guerilla force currently laying siege to the regime of Idriss Deby is being directed from Doha by his nephew, Timan Erdimi. The situation is acutely embarrassing for the Chadian president but also for Paris, which is allies with Qatar but is fighting alongside the Chadian army against the rebellion. For some weeks now, the French government has been trying to marshal all the influence at its disposal to oblige the Emir of Qatar to keep tighter control over his turbulent Chadian guest. [...]
